Let’s Get Sleazy!!!

Florida’s second best publication, The Rimmer, is presenting its 5th annual Sleazy Awards on Monday, March 10, at Bill’s, followed by a post party at the Boardwalk. The theme this year is “The Sleazy Prom: A Black Jock Affair.” Proceeds will be going to Shadowood II, a structured group home for homeless men and women who are living with HIV/AIDS and various life-threatening illnesses. Past events from The Rimmer have raised over $29,000 for local charities. Awards to be given out include: Sleaziest Bartender, Sleaziest Bar Manager, Sleaziest Sales Clerk, Best Top in Town, and 14 other categories. Winners will be chosen by paper ballots and online ballots on www.rimmermag.com. Paper ballots are provided at participating bars. The show will once again be hosted by the dynamic duo of Russell from Ramrod and Daisy Deadpetals with Electra providing the intermission entertainment. Other entertainers include D.J. Miik, Miranda, and a host of others. For more information, contact Guido at (954) 240-9054 or co-chair Kevin Wright at (954) 600-8575.
